This book is designed and developed to link the theory, emerging methods, and applications. The theory part focuses on explaining the background and concept of multi-attribute decision-making. The emerging methods part elaborates on frequently adopted and emerging approaches in multi-attribute decision-making. The applications part provides in-depth illustrations of various methods using numerical examples. The book:
The book is primarily written for graduate students and academic researchers in the fields of mechanical engineering, engineering mathematics, mathematics, engineering design, production engineering, manufacturing engineering, and industrial engineering.
